There was a time when people had to use their imaginations as to what antics went on backstage after a fashion show or gig etc. Celebrities kept their 'good face' for their fans and remained someone to idolise or look up to before they all went for a well earned booze up in private.
Spoiling the mystery these days are phones and Blackberries welded to every celebs hand, spoon feeding us every sight they see and in some cases spoiling any remaining dignity they have via Twitter, so consider this - Roxanne Lowit was the ONLY photographer in the late 1970s, until relatively recently, to attend the exclusive post fashion show parties. Loved by the A listers she was smuggled in by the likes of Jerry Hall and took fantastic and intimate photographs of those she rubbed shoulders with. Her photography offered a unique insight into the hallowed unseen worlds inhabited only by the cream of the crop.
An exhibition dedicated to the Grand Dame of celebrity and backstage photography is now on entitled 'Legendary Privicy' at the at the Kaune, Sudendorf Gallery in Cologne, Germany, providing Joe Bloggs the chance to see the rare scenes no one else did in New York from 1979 to 1999. The exhibition runs until Sept 3rd.
